Output 31ae5993caf910b6a673e95048aa82da2de4bc14578a576e56ee12e794ad361c:127

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82f93899b768fea9137dd0dc67b1aa55f6b5cf9bafb85d61a6c5d1d963771c46
address
bc1pstun3xdhdrl2jyma6rwx0vd22hmttnum47u96cdxchgajcmhr3rqt747xr
transaction
31ae5993caf910b6a673e95048aa82da2de4bc14578a576e56ee12e794ad361c
spent
true